This chapter compares the economic aspects of nuclear power plants with gas-fired power stations, emphasizing the higher upfront costs but potentially higher long-term profits of nuclear power due to lower fuel expenses. It also addresses the financial obstacles and time constraints involved in constructing and running a nuclear facility, underscoring the substantial initial investment and time before revenue generation.
